深圳软件开发
软件开发测试时间比例(「游戏开发测试时间优化的关键因素」)
来源:深圳本凡软件 发布时间:2023-10-31 点击浏览:207次

摘要

软件开发测试时间比例是指软件开发过程中,用于测试的时间占整个开发过程时间的比例。本文将从四个方面详细阐述软件开发测试时间比例的重要性和影响。首先,通过引出读者的兴趣和提供背景信息,为下文做好铺垫。

正文

一、测试时间比例对软件质量的影响

测试时间比例对于软件的质量具有重要影响。首先,充足的测试时间可以保证软件的功能正常、稳定性好,减少出现bug的概率,提高软件的可靠性。其次,测试时间的合理分配可以帮助发现和解决各种安全漏洞和性能问题,从而提升软件的安全性和性能。最后,适当的测试时间比例还可以提高软件的用户体验,确保软件界面友好、操作便捷,增加用户的满意度。

二、测试时间比例与项目进度的平衡

虽然测试时间比例对软件质量至关重要,但与项目进度的平衡也不可忽视。如果软件开发的时间过长,测试时间过多,则可能导致项目进度延误,给成本和资源带来额外的压力。因此,测试时间比例的合理分配可以平衡软件质量与项目进度之间的关系,确保项目按时交付,并在质量上达到客户的要求。

三、测试时间比例对成本的影响

适当的测试时间比例可以帮助减少软件开发中的bug和错误,进而降低软件维护的成本。通过充分的测试,可以及早发现和解决问题,避免问题在上线后被用户反馈,从而节省了后期修复的成本。此外,测试时间的合理分配还能够提高软件的稳定性和可靠性,减少用户因软件问题而产生的投诉和退款,提高用户满意度,进而增加软件的收益。

四、测试时间比例的优化策略

为了提高软件开发测试时间比例的效果,可以采取以下优化策略。首先,合理规划软件开发和测试的时间分配,确保不同阶段的测试能得到充分的时间和资源支持。其次,引入自动化测试技术,对重复性的测试工作进行自动化,提高测试效率和准确性。再次,建立严格的测试流程和规范,确保测试工作按照标准进行,提高测试效果和质量。最后,加强开发人员和测试人员之间的合作和沟通,共同努力,提高测试效率和结果。

结论

通过对软件开发测试时间比例的详细阐述,我们可以看出,测试时间比例对软件质量、项目进度和成本都具有重要影响。合理分配测试时间比例可以提高软件质量,保证项目按时交付,降低维护成本。为了更好地优化测试时间比例,可以采取一系列措施,包括合理规划时间、引入自动化测试技术、建立严格的测试流程和加强开发测试人员的合作。进一步研究和实践将有助于不断完善软件开发测试时间比例的理论和实践,提高软件开发的效率和质量。